The Dance Phenomenon: 'GUCCI GANG' Dance ft Bailey Sok, Kaycee Rice, Sean Lew

The instantly recognizable "Gucci Gang" dance, choreographed by the immensely talented trio of Bailey Sok, Kaycee Rice, and Sean Lew, transcends its association with the Lil Pump song. While the song itself is undeniably controversial, the dance stands as a testament to the power of creative expression. The choreography, a seamless blend of hip-hop, contemporary, and jazz influences, is technically demanding yet visually captivating. Its popularity exploded online, leading to countless imitations and reinterpretations across various social media platforms. This viral spread highlights the inherent appeal of well-crafted choreography and the ability of dance to transcend musical context. The dance's success isn't merely about its technical prowess; it's about its infectious energy and the charisma of its creators. Bailey Sok, Kaycee Rice, and Sean Lew, already established names in the dance community, brought their individual styles and expertise to create a piece that resonates with audiences of all ages and dance backgrounds. This dance, independent of its controversial namesake, represents a significant achievement in contemporary dance choreography and viral video culture. The choreography's versatility allows for adaptation and personalization, making it a perfect vehicle for individual expression within a shared framework.
